Focus on the 2025 Rookie Class
The base set includes 200 cards, spotlighting players who made their Major League debuts during the 2025 season along with scenes from the All-Star Game at Truist Park in Atlanta. Collectors can expect a wide range of refractor parallels, from traditional silvers to vibrant color versions and low-numbered exclusives that Chrome fans know well.Autographs and Rookie Highlights
Autograph content plays a major role again this year. The returning Lava Lamp Rookie Autographs mix bright, swirling backgrounds with on-card signatures, while the 1990 Topps Baseball Autographs carry over from the main Chrome release, blending a retro look with modern presentation.The most sought-after cards, however, are the Rookie Debut Patch Autographs. These one-of-one cards use authentic patches from the jersey worn during a player’s first Major League game, paired with a hard-signed autograph. Each card represents a single, unrepeatable moment in the player’s career, making them among the most valuable pieces Topps produces.
Inserts and Case Hits
Several popular insert themes return for 2025, including Fortune 15, Power Players, 1990 Topps Baseball, and Night Terrors. Each set offers its own mix of nostalgia, star power, and standout design.Collectors will also be chasing the rarest cards in the release — Helix and Exposé — both of which are case hits with limited availability. These cards are designed to add an extra layer of excitement to case breaks and high-end chases.
Release Overview
Topps has not yet announced full details for pack or box configurations, but pre-orders are scheduled to begin on November 10, 2025, through Topps.com. As in previous years, multiple formats are expected, including Hobby, Jumbo, and Mega Boxes, each offering its own exclusive refractors and autograph odds.Quick Breakdown
- Base set: 200 cards
- Key focus: 2025 rookies and All-Star Game moments
- Main autographs: Lava Lamp, 1990 Topps, and Rookie Debut Patch
- Case hits: Helix and Exposé
- Pre-order date: November 10, 2025
- Release date: To be announced
